当前位置:主页 > 区块链 > 比特币 > 比特币密钥常见问题

比特币密钥是什么样子?比特币公钥和私匙的区别

2024-08-28 08:52:05 | 来源: | 作者:佚名
比特币密钥是什么样子?在比特币网络中,密钥是实现资产控制和交易验证的基础,比特币密钥通常以一长串字符的形式出现,它们在比特币的使用中扮演着至关重要的角色,下文将为大家详细介绍

对于比特币用户来说,与之最密切相关的就是比特币密钥,它是比特币运作方式的重要组成部分,密钥能够识别钱包的合法所有者,因此用户必须确保密钥的安全以维持访问并防止黑客攻击。对于一些新手来说,还是搞不懂比特币密钥是什么样子?就资料分析来看,比特币密钥是一个用于保护和管理比特币所有权的加密工具,它包括私钥和公钥,每种密钥都有特定的形式和用途。下面小编为大家详细说说。

比特币密钥是什么样子?

比特币的密钥包括公钥和私钥,它们通常是一串由数字和字母组成的字符串。这些密钥是用来加密和解密交易的,以及验证交易的有效性。私钥是一个256位的数字,通常表示为64个十六进制字符(0-9和a-f)。这是最重要的密钥,因为拥有它就相当于拥有比特币的所有权。私钥必须保持秘密,如果被他人获取,你的比特币可能会被盗。

公钥是由私钥通过椭圆曲线乘法生成的。公钥用于创建比特币地址,并且可以安全地公开。公钥的长度是65字节,通常以十六进制格式表示,前缀04表示它是一个未压缩的公钥。

比特币地址是从公钥派生的,用于接收比特币。地址是公钥通过哈希函数(SHA-256和RIPEMD-160)处理后生成的,最后进行Base58Check编码。比特币地址通常以“1”或“3”开头,长度约为26到35个字符。

比特币公钥和私匙的区别

针对密钥配送这一难题,密码学史上伟大的发明——非对称加密出现了。非对称加密有一对密钥,分别是私钥和公钥,公钥和私钥一一对应,私钥需要保密,而公钥则是可以公开的。加密和解密不是用同一个密钥。

回到之前的例子,你朋友去配了一对钥匙(钥匙A和钥匙B),钥匙A上锁柜子之后,必须要钥匙B才能开锁柜子。你朋友把钥匙A邮寄给你,你用这把钥匙把信件锁到柜子中,然后将柜子邮寄给你朋友,你朋友用钥匙B打开柜子取出信件。细心的小伙伴又想到了,朋友把钥匙A寄给自己的时候,可能会被快递人员偷配钥匙,但是快递人员即使持有钥匙A,他也不能打开柜子,因为钥匙A上锁柜子之后,只有钥匙B才能开锁,整个过程,钥匙B一直在朋友手上,只要朋友不把钥匙B弄丢,这个柜子就只能由朋友打开。

在非对称加密中,钥匙A就相当于公钥,它被人知道也没有关系,钥匙B相当于私钥,它需要持有人小心保存,不能丢失。“上锁柜子”和“开锁柜子”相对于“加密过程”和“解密过程”,而且在非对称加密中,最重要的是加密和解密用的不是同一把密钥,而是一对密钥,即私钥和公钥。比特币公钥就是通过私钥推导而来,公钥继续转换变成账户地址,而且是不能反向推导出私钥的,私钥和公钥是一对,用户需要妥善保管好自己的私钥,而公钥和账户地址都是可以公开的。

比特币密钥有什么用?

比特币密钥在比特币交易中扮演着至关重要的角色,‌它们的主要作用包括签署交易、‌验证交易以及生成比特币地址。比特币私钥用于签署比特币交易,‌这证明了交易的发起者有权花费相关的比特币。‌私钥的这一功能确保了只有掌握私钥的用户才能控制账户并转移比特币。‌

公钥用于验证数字签名的真实性,‌从而确保交易的安全性和有效性。‌通过公钥验证数字签名,‌可以确保交易的有效性和真实性,‌保护交易不受欺诈和篡改。公钥被用于生成比特币地址,‌作为接收比特币的标识。‌每个比特币地址都对应一个唯一的私钥,‌这个私钥是通过伪随机数生成器生成的,‌具有高度的安全性和不可预测性。‌‌‌

比特币密钥是比特币加密体系的核心,‌其生成和使用需要使用复杂的密码学算法,‌以确保交易的安全性和有效性。‌只有使用正确的比特币密钥,‌用户才可以安全地发送和接收比特币。‌因此,‌比特币密钥的安全存储和备份至关重要,‌以防止资产丢失或被盗。

以上全部内容就是对比特币密钥是什么样子这一问题的解答,比特币地址是从公钥派生的,用于接收比特币。地址是公钥通过哈希函数处理后生成的,最后进行Base58Check编码。比特币地址通常以“1”或“3”开头,长度约为26到35个字符。需要注意的是,私钥和公钥的关系是单向的,‌即私钥可以生成公钥,‌但公钥不能转换回私钥,‌这种单向性保证了比特币交易的安全性。‌另外,公钥可以在任何地方共享而不必担心私钥的泄露。

免责声明:本文只为提供市场讯息,所有内容及观点仅供参考,不构成投资建议,不代表本站观点和立场。投资者应自行决策与交易,对投资者交易形成的直接或间接损失,作者及本站将不承担任何责任。!
Tag:比特币   密钥  
更多

热门币种

  • 币名
    最新价格
    24H涨幅
  • bitcoin BTC 比特币

    BTC

    比特币

    $ 72792.64¥ 501985.32
    +2.99%
  • ethereum ETH 以太坊

    ETH

    以太坊

    $ 2130.84¥ 14694.48
    +4.35%
  • tether USDT 泰达币

    USDT

    泰达币

    $ 1.0002¥ 6.8974
    +0.03%
  • binance-coin BNB 币安币

    BNB

    币安币

    $ 657.03¥ 4530.94
    +1.55%
  • ripple XRP 瑞波币

    XRP

    瑞波币

    $ 1.4375¥ 9.9131
    +3.66%
  • usdc USDC USD Coin

    USDC

    USD Coin

    $ 0.9997¥ 6.894
    +0.01%
  • solana SOL Solana

    SOL

    Solana

    $ 91.6341¥ 631.91
    +2.94%
  • tron TRX 波场

    TRX

    波场

    $ 0.2842¥ 1.9598
    +0%
  • dogecoin DOGE 狗狗币

    DOGE

    狗狗币

    $ 0.095897¥ 0.6613
    +4.52%
  • cardano ADA 艾达币

    ADA

    艾达币

    $ 0.2755¥ 1.8998
    +3.18%

币圈快讯

  • 纽约证券交易所母公司投资OKX估值250亿美元

    2026-03-05 20:35
    据Fortune报道,纽约证券交易所(NYSE)的母公司已对加密货币交易所OKX进行投资,估值达250亿美元。
  • 币安上线Opinion(OPN)及相关产品

    2026-03-05 20:32
    币安将于2026年3月5日21:00上线Opinion(OPN)相关产品,包括币安理财、闪兑、VIP借币、杠杆及合约。用户可通过币安理财平台申购OPN保本赚币产品,并在上线后通过一键买币和闪兑平台交易OPN。币安合约将上线OPNU本位永续合约,最高杠杆可达25倍。
  • OpenClaw出现自我攻击漏洞误执行Bash命令致密钥泄露

    2026-03-05 20:29
    Web3安全公司GoPlus发文称,AI开发工具OpenClaw近日被曝出现一次自我攻击安全事件。在执行自动化任务时,系统在调用Shell命令创建GitHubIssue过程中构造了错误的Bash指令,意外触发命令注入,导致大量敏感环境变量被公开。事件中,AI生成的字符串包含反引号包裹的set,被Bash解释为命令替换并自动执行。由于Bash在无参数执行set时会输出当前所有环境变量,最终导致超过100行敏感信息(包括Telegram密钥、认证Token等)被直接写入GitHubIssue并公开发布。GoPlus建议,在AI自动化开发或测试场景中,应尽量使用API调用替代直接拼接Shell命令,并遵循最小权限原则隔离环境变量,同时禁用高风险执行模式,并在关键操作中引入人工审核机制。
  • 分析BTC与美元同步走强引发市场关注近期关键阻力位或在7.4万美元

    2026-03-05 20:26
    据市场消息,比特币目前正在逼近7.4万美元关键阻力位,中东冲突爆发以来累计涨幅已超过10%。值得注意的是,此轮上涨出现在全球股市风险偏好下降、美元同步走强的背景下。美元指数(DXY)本周上涨超过1%,并在周三触及99.68,为去年11月以来高位。历史上,比特币通常与美元呈负相关,但自特朗普在2024年大选获胜并提出亲加密政策以来,两者多次出现同步涨跌的情况。
  • GoPlus与Custos达成战略合作推动代币锁定业务的发展

    2026-03-05 20:21
    GoPlus宣布与Custos建立长期战略合作伙伴关系。双方团队将围绕代币锁定业务展开深度合作,探索链上资产管理的新可能性,并将代币锁定从基本工具提升至协议级资本战略基础设施。 双方将保持清晰的界限和不同的角色,在独立发展的同时实现战略协同。Custos将专注于资产管理协议层的创新,推动代币锁定业务向更高层次发展。GoPlus将继续构建安全基础设施,同时为Custos的发展提供战略支持。
  • 查看更多